When Should You Replace a Vacuum Battery?
Quick Answer
You should replace a vacuum battery when a full charge gives much less runtime than before, the vacuum repeatedly shuts down under normal use, or the battery can no longer charge properly after other causes have been ruled out. There is no universal replacement age, so I judge the battery by performance, condition, and the manufacturer’s guidance, including proper cordless vacuum battery care.
Signs I would check first
- Short runtime: The vacuum runs for far less time than it did when the battery was healthy.
- Sudden shutdowns: The machine stops even though the battery appeared charged.
- Charging problems: The battery will not reach or maintain a normal charge.
- Power loss: Performance drops under a normal cleaning load despite clear airflow.
- Physical damage: Swelling, cracking, leaking, unusual heat, or an abnormal smell means you should stop using the battery.

What Does Replacing a Vacuum Battery Mean?
A vacuum battery replacement means removing or professionally servicing a rechargeable battery that can no longer power the vacuum normally. It is most relevant to cordless stick, handheld, and robot vacuums.
Many newer cordless models use lithium-ion batteries. However, battery design, chemistry, charging controls, and replacement procedures differ between models.
Removable vs. built-in vacuum batteries
Some batteries click out with a release button. Others are attached with screws, while sealed designs may require authorized service.
- Click-in battery: Usually the simplest type for an owner to replace.
- Screw-mounted battery: May be user-replaceable when the manual provides instructions.
- Built-in battery: May require a manufacturer or qualified repair service.
I always check the model number before ordering anything. Batteries that look similar may use different connectors, voltage requirements, or battery-management electronics.
The owner’s manual should therefore override general advice. Never force a battery from a housing that was not designed for routine removal.
When Should You Replace a Vacuum Battery?

You should consider replacement when the battery’s usable performance has clearly declined and basic troubleshooting does not restore it. A single short cleaning session is not enough evidence by itself.
Your runtime has dropped sharply
This is the sign I find easiest to track. Compare the vacuum with its own earlier performance rather than an advertised maximum runtime.
For example, imagine your vacuum normally handled your kitchen and living room in one charge. If it now stops halfway through the kitchen under the same conditions, that change matters.
The vacuum shuts off despite being charged
An aging battery may struggle when the motor demands more power. The vacuum can then stop even though the charge indicator did not appear empty.
Do not assume every shutdown means battery failure. A blocked airway, dirty filter, overheated motor, or jammed brush roll can also trigger stopping or pulsing.
The battery no longer charges normally
A battery that never completes charging, rapidly loses its charge while unused, or works only for a brief period may be failing. Check the charger and electrical connection before replacing it.
The battery is physically damaged
Swelling, cracking, leaking, excessive heat, or an unusual odor changes the situation from routine troubleshooting to a safety issue. Stop using and charging the battery.
Expert Alert: Do not open, puncture, crush, rebuild, or attempt an internal repair on a damaged lithium-ion battery. Follow the manufacturer or qualified battery-handling guidance instead.
How Do You Confirm the Battery Is Actually the Problem?

Before buying a battery, I run a controlled test. This avoids spending money when a filter, clog, charger, or brush roll is causing the symptoms.
Use the same conditions for your runtime test
- Charge fully: Charge the vacuum according to its manual.
- Clean the filters: Service only filters the manufacturer says can be cleaned.
- Clear blockages: Inspect the floor head, wand, hose, and intake path.
- Check the brush roll: Remove wrapped hair, fibers, and thread.
- Select one mode: Avoid comparing Eco mode one day with Boost mode the next.
- Time the run: Use the same floor head and similar flooring during each test.
This simple process gives me a useful baseline. If runtime remains dramatically shorter under repeatable conditions, battery degradation becomes a stronger possibility.
Compare battery symptoms with other vacuum problems
| Symptom | Battery More Likely? | Other Cause to Check | Useful Next Step |
|---|---|---|---|
| Runtime keeps getting shorter | Yes | High-power mode or heavy floor load | Retest in the same normal mode |
| Vacuum pulses or cuts out | Possibly | Clog, dirty filter, or overheating | Clear airflow and allow cooling |
| No charging indication | Possibly | Charger, dock, outlet, or connection | Follow model-specific charging checks |
| Weak suction | Not necessarily | Filter, full bin, clog, or air leak | Inspect the airflow system first |
| Swollen or damaged pack | Replacement required | Physical battery damage | Stop using it and seek safe disposal guidance |

How Long Should a Vacuum Battery Last?
There is no reliable number of years that applies to every cordless vacuum battery. As of 2026, manufacturers still use different battery packs, power-management systems, charging strategies, and operating modes.
I would be cautious with any rule claiming that every vacuum battery must be replaced after a fixed number of years. Battery condition matters more than the calendar alone.
What causes vacuum batteries to wear faster?
- Repeated high-power use: Maximum or boost modes demand more energy from the battery.
- High temperatures: Prolonged heat can accelerate lithium-ion battery aging.
- Heavy cleaning loads: Thick carpet and powered accessories may require more energy.
- Long storage periods: Storage conditions should follow the vacuum manufacturer’s instructions.
- Normal aging: Rechargeable batteries gradually lose usable capacity through repeated use.
I focus on the trend instead of one disappointing cleaning session. A steady decline across several properly charged tests tells me more.
Keep a simple runtime baseline
You do not need laboratory equipment. Note roughly how much of your normal cleaning route the vacuum completes after a full charge.
If your routine, power setting, attachment, and floor type stay similar, changes become easier to spot. That makes future battery decisions much less subjective.
Should You Replace the Battery or the Whole Vacuum?
A battery replacement usually makes sense when the vacuum itself still cleans well and the correct battery is available. Replacing the whole machine may make more sense when several expensive problems appear together.
Replace only the battery when:
- The motor still sounds and performs normally.
- The brush roll and cleaner head remain in good condition.
- The dustbin, seals, wand, and attachments are usable.
- The manufacturer supports battery replacement for your model.
- The replacement battery cost is reasonable compared with a new vacuum.
Consider replacing the vacuum when:
- The motor is also failing or making abnormal noises.
- The main body, electronics, or charging system has significant damage.
- Several major parts need replacement at the same time.
- The correct battery is discontinued or unavailable.
- A sealed battery requires a repair that exceeds the machine’s practical value.
I also consider how well the vacuum still fits the household. Spending money on a battery is less appealing if the machine already struggles with your flooring, pet hair, or cleaning area.
Do not base the decision on battery age alone. Compare the battery price, repair needs, vacuum condition, and realistic cost of a suitable replacement machine.
How Do You Replace and Dispose of a Vacuum Battery Safely?
Replacement should follow the instructions for the exact model. Do not assume a video for a similar-looking vacuum uses the same procedure.
Before replacing the battery
- Switch the vacuum off completely.
- Disconnect it from the charger or charging dock.
- Confirm the exact model and battery part number.
- Inspect the old battery for swelling, cracks, leaks, or abnormal heat.
- Use a manufacturer-approved replacement when required by the vacuum’s instructions or warranty terms.
A click-in battery may need only a release button. Screw-mounted packs require more care, while sealed batteries may need professional service.
Expert Alert: If the vacuum has exposed wiring, scorched electrical parts, a burning smell, or suspected internal electrical damage, stop using it. Have the machine inspected by a qualified repair professional.
Do not put a lithium-ion vacuum battery in household trash
The U.S. Environmental Protection Agency says lithium-ion batteries should not go into household garbage or municipal recycling bins. They should go to an appropriate battery recycler or household hazardous-waste collection point.
The EPA also recommends protecting battery terminals from contact during disposal or recycling. You can review its current used lithium-ion battery guidance before handling an old pack.
Local rules can differ, especially outside the United States. Check your local waste authority or the vacuum manufacturer’s recycling instructions.
Frequently Asked Questions About Vacuum Battery Replacement
Can a cordless vacuum battery be replaced?
Often, yes. Some cordless vacuums use click-in or screw-mounted batteries, while others have built-in packs that require servicing. Check the exact model’s manual before buying or removing a battery.
How do I know if my vacuum battery is going bad?
Common warning signs include much shorter runtime, repeated shutdowns, poor charge retention, and charging problems. Confirm that filters, airflow paths, brush rolls, chargers, and electrical connections are working before blaming the battery.
Should I replace a vacuum battery just because it is old?
No. Battery age can provide context, but there is no universal replacement age for every vacuum. I would replace it when measurable performance loss or physical condition shows that the battery is no longer doing its job safely.
Why does my cordless vacuum battery die so quickly?
The battery may be aging, but high-power mode, thick carpets, motorized attachments, airflow restrictions, and charging issues can also reduce apparent runtime. Retest after basic maintenance using the same cleaning mode and attachment.
Can a dirty filter make the battery seem bad?
Yes. Restricted airflow can make the vacuum work poorly and may contribute to overheating or shutdown behavior on some models. Clean or replace filters only according to the manufacturer’s instructions, then test the vacuum again.
Can I use a third-party replacement vacuum battery?
Compatibility and safety requirements vary by manufacturer and model. Check the vacuum maker’s instructions, warranty terms, required specifications, and approved replacement options before using a non-original battery.
What should I do with a swollen vacuum battery?
Stop using and charging it. Do not puncture, crush, open, or place it in normal household trash; contact the manufacturer, a qualified battery recycler, or your local hazardous-waste program for safe handling instructions.
